Re: [PATCH 2/6] nfsd: swap fs root in NFSd kthreads

From: J. Bruce Fields
Date: Mon Dec 10 2012 - 15:28:31 EST


On Thu, Dec 06, 2012 at 06:34:47PM +0300, Stanislav Kinsbursky wrote:
> NFSd does lookup. Lookup is done starting from current->fs->root.
> NFSd is a kthread, cloned by kthreadd, and thus have global (but luckely
> unshared) root.
> So we have to swap root to those, which process, started NFSd, has. Because
> that process can be in a container with it's own root.

This doesn't sound right to me.

Which lookups exactly do you see being done relative to
current->fs->root ?

--b.

> diff --git a/fs/nfsd/netns.h b/fs/nfsd/netns.h
> index abfc97c..5c423c6 100644
> --- a/fs/nfsd/netns.h
> +++ b/fs/nfsd/netns.h
> @@ -101,6 +101,7 @@ struct nfsd_net {
> struct timeval nfssvc_boot;
>
> struct svc_serv *nfsd_serv;
> + struct path root;
> };
>
> extern int nfsd_net_id;
> diff --git a/fs/nfsd/nfssvc.c b/fs/nfsd/nfssvc.c
> index cee62ab..177bb60 100644
> --- a/fs/nfsd/nfssvc.c
> +++ b/fs/nfsd/nfssvc.c
> @@ -392,6 +392,7 @@ int nfsd_create_serv(struct net *net)
>
> set_max_drc();
> do_gettimeofday(&nn->nfssvc_boot); /* record boot time */
> + get_fs_root(current->fs, &nn->root);
> return 0;
> }
>
> @@ -426,8 +427,10 @@ void nfsd_destroy(struct net *net)
> if (destroy)
> svc_shutdown_net(nn->nfsd_serv, net);
> svc_destroy(nn->nfsd_serv);
> - if (destroy)
> + if (destroy) {
> + path_put(&nn->root);
> nn->nfsd_serv = NULL;
> + }
> }
>
> int nfsd_set_nrthreads(int n, int *nthreads, struct net *net)
> @@ -533,6 +536,25 @@ out:
> return error;
> }
>
> +/*
> + * This function is actually slightly modified set_fs_root()<F9>
> + */
> +static void nfsd_swap_root(struct net *net)
> +{
> + struct nfsd_net *nn = net_generic(net, nfsd_net_id);
> + struct fs_struct *fs = current->fs;
> + struct path old_root;
> +
> + path_get(&nn->root);
> + spin_lock(&fs->lock);
> + write_seqcount_begin(&fs->seq);
> + old_root = fs->root;
> + fs->root = nn->root;
> + write_seqcount_end(&fs->seq);
> + spin_unlock(&fs->lock);
> + if (old_root.dentry)
> + path_put(&old_root);
> +}
>
> /*
> * This is the NFS server kernel thread
> @@ -559,6 +581,15 @@ nfsd(void *vrqstp)
> current->fs->umask = 0;
>
> /*
> + * We have to swap NFSd kthread's fs->root.
> + * Why so? Because NFSd can be started in container, which has it's own
> + * root.
> + * And so what? NFSd lookup files, and lookup start from
> + * current->fs->root.
> + */
> + nfsd_swap_root(net);
> +
> + /*
> * thread is spawned with all signals set to SIG_IGN, re-enable
> * the ones that will bring down the thread
> */
>
